Joint Task Force Carson Soldiers start the 2-mile run component of the Army Physical Fitness Test at McKibben Physical Fitness Center during Day 1 of the Master Fitness Trainer course, Oct. 20, 2014. The Soldiers have to complete each event with 80 percent in order to graduate. The four-week course was designed to provide selected leaders with the skills necessary to become unit-level physical fitness trainers and advisers to the commanders on a variety of fitness issues.
